Position Safety Medical Writer

Job Location - Electronic City - Bangalore

**Your Role**:

- Support Global Patient Safety (GPS) Safety Scientists and Safety Strategy Leads with regards to safety medical writing (SMW) activities.
- Assist senior staff in developing sections of a wide range of pharmacovigilance documents including but not limited to various Periodic Safety Reports, Signal Evaluation Reports, Safety Strategy and Core Benefit-Risk Documents, Risk-Management Plans, Patient Safety Narratives and Health Hazard Reports.
- Responsible for proofreading, building and populating tables and drafting appendices.
- Produce high quality, accurate and fit-for purpose documents with clear conclusions.
- Effectively and clearly communicate technical, medical, and scientific information in critical submission and internal PV documents in order to deliver high quality reports within the specified timelines.
- Performs quality control of SMW deliverables for data accuracy, consistency, editing, and ensuring alignment with the processes, templates and regulations.
- Participate in meetings related to key PV activities.
- Collaborate cross functionally for continuous improvement of standards and best practices for medical writing

**Who you are**:

- Graduate degree or equivalent job experience with comprehensive pharmacovigilance knowledge of theories, principles and concepts, MD/PhD or advanced science degree.
- Excellent written and spoken English (including medical terminology) with a familiarity with AMA style guide.
- Profound pharmacovigilance experience ( 5 to 7 years' experience in drug/patient safety) required.
- Demonstrated experience in Periodic Safety Reports of interpretation & presentation of aggregate safety data.
- Strong knowledge of regulations and guidelines (FDA, EMA, ICH, EU GVP, etc.).
- Experience in working in electronic document management systems (EDMS), signal management and benefit-risk assessment is beneficial.
- Proven experience in ability to consistently produce documents of high quality and express complex data in a concise and easy-to-read way.
- Comprehensive experience in working in cross-functional, global teams, across different regions and time zones.
- A flexible attitude with respect to work assignments and new learning; readily adapts to changes.
